Pakistan Sees Launch of New Electric Bikes and Scooters as Inverex Unveils Inverex GO Range

ISLAMABAD: Pakistan’s electric vehicle market is gaining momentum as solar energy solutions provider Inverex has launched a new range of electric bikes and scooters under its Inverex GO brand.

The newly introduced lineup offers options ranging from scooters designed for daily commuting to higher-speed electric bikes with longer claimed ranges. The models feature different motor capacities, battery configurations, charging times and ranges, while selected variants come with fast-charging and battery-swapping technology.

Battery swapping emerges as a key feature

The battery-swapping technology introduced in the Charlie Swap, Roar Swap and Volterra Swap models is among the key features of the new Inverex GO range.

The company says the batteries in these models can be replaced in approximately 30 seconds, potentially allowing users to continue their journey without waiting several hours for a battery to recharge.

The new lineup includes relatively low-power models aimed at daily commuters as well as higher-performance variants featuring 3,000-watt motors, claimed ranges of up to 150 kilometres and top speeds of up to 90 km/h.

Among the newly introduced models, the Fire Bird Pro stands out with a claimed range of up to 200 kilometres, making it one of the most notable offerings in Inverex’s new electric vehicle lineup.
